  • IE 10 and store say computer is not connected to the internet

    Original title: windows store and internet explore 10

    the windows store and internet explore 10 say not connected to the internet and I am someone can help? !!

    Hi Pop Boy,

    Please come back to us!

     

    You said that the connection is limited.

    This means that the PC is connected to the router, but the PC has not been assigned a valid IP address, so you can not actually in the Internet. It can also indicate that a valid IP address has been assigned, but the PC isn't an Internet connection. If you are connected to a home network, try restarting the router. If the system is connected to a domain or a public network, contact technical support for this network.

  • ITunes 12.3.2.35 says it can not connect to the internet, no connection, but my internet works fine.  I installed Windows 7.  Any help?

    I am using windows 7 on my pc.  I just installed the new Itunes, 12.3.2.35, and it does not connect to the internet.  I ran diagnostics and it said that the only test that failed was "secure link to iTunes Store failed.  What could be the problem?

    Thanks for any help.

    Yes, I had the same issue and have also windows 7. Here's what I did to remedy.

    1. go to your Start menu and in the search the bottom type in cmd menu.

    2. right click on cmd at the top of the menu, and then click "Run as Administrator". A black box should appear.

    3. type netsh winsock reset. It should invite you to restart your computer.

    4 restart your computer and then open itunes again.

    I did and now my itunes is on the rise and running and connection to the store. I hope this helps!
